Parkland shooting survivor David Hogg is calling on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ene (R-Ga.) to apologize to families of shooting victims after expressing doubt over whether the events happened.
She previously questioned whether the Parkland shooting was planned and called Hogg a âpaid actor.â
Greene expressed support for comments on Facebook in 2018 suggesting the Sandy Hook Elementary School shooting was a âstagedâ event.
She also considered on Facebook whether the Las Vegas massacre in 2017 was part of a conspiracy to enforce gun control.
CNNâs Alisyn Camerota on Friday asked Hogg about his thoughts regarding Greeneâs suggestion she could relate to what he went through.
âThe thing I care most about in this situation isnât so much myself, but itâs the real people that she offended, which are the families in Parkland and Las Vegas and Sandy Hook that have a permanently empty bedroom, that have a permanently empty place at the dinner table,â Hogg said.
He continued, âTheyâre the people that are the real victims here that deserve the apology, not me. And thatâs really what upsets me is that sheâs detracting from their suffering and their experience because she canât know their pain.â

He argued she cannot know the pain these families have experienced because âthey had the worst possible thing in the world happen to them.â
Hogg continued, âThey are the ones that deserve an apology.â
Late last month, Hogg called on House Minority Leader Kevin McCarthy (R-Calif.) to strip Greene of her committee assignments over her comments, as IJR previously reported.
âMy message to Kevin McCarthy is take all of her committee assignments away, along with that also, donât support her when she runs for re-election again, and try to get her primaried,â Hogg said.
He added, âIf you say this is not your party, actually call it out and hold her accountable because Republicans always act as if theyâre the party of decency and respect, but would the party of decency and respect question whether or not school shootings happened?â
House Democrats voted to strip Greene of her committee assignments on Thursday night, as IJR reported.
